Laser Hair Removal Technologies Used in St. Petersburg
Diode lasers with multiple wavelengths require about 30% fewer sessions than many single-wavelength systems. The Alexandrite laser at 755 nm often reaches around 80% hair reduction in 4-6 sessions for fair to olive skin. Nd:YAG wavelengths provide the safest option for darker skin types IV through VI because they target deeper structures while sparing surface pigment.
Soprano ICE technology with SHR (Super Hair Removal) offers a nearly pain-free experience for many clients. The device gradually heats the follicles with repeated passes instead of using single high-energy pulses. This approach can feel more comfortable while still delivering effective results when used correctly.
Typical Treatment Areas and Session Counts
| Treatment Area | Sessions Needed | Skin Type Considerations |
|---|---|---|
| Underarms | 6-8 sessions | Suitable for all skin types |
| Bikini/Brazilian | 8-10 sessions | Requires expertise in sensitive areas |
| Lower Legs | 6-8 sessions | Produces strong results across skin types |
| Full Face | 8-12 sessions | Needs careful wavelength and setting selection |
Pre-Treatment Preparation Checklist for Better Results
Proper preparation improves both safety and effectiveness. Shave the treatment area 1-3 days before your visit so the laser can target follicles below the skin. Avoid waxing, plucking, or threading for at least 4 weeks before treatment so follicles remain intact.
Review medications such as antibiotics or acne treatments that increase light sensitivity. Doxycycline and other tetracycline antibiotics usually need to be discontinued about 2 weeks before treatment, under guidance from your prescribing clinician.
Sun avoidance plays a major role in safe laser hair removal. Avoid sun exposure and tanning for at least 6 weeks before treatment. Extra pigment from tanning can reduce laser effectiveness and raise the risk of burns or pigment changes.
Laser Hair Removal Safety and Risk Management
Professional laser hair removal has a strong safety record when performed by trained providers. Serious complications such as burns or pigment disorders occur in less than 0.5-1% of cases at certified centers. Most issues relate to recent sun exposure, incorrect settings, or inadequate training.
Current evidence does not link laser hair removal to skin cancer. These devices use non-ionizing radiation, which does not alter DNA in the way ionizing radiation can.
Common contraindications include pacemakers, certain metal implants, and photosensitizing medications that raise burn risk. Careful provider selection and strict adherence to protocols greatly reduce the chance of serious complications.

Number of Laser Hair Removal Sessions in St. Petersburg
Most clients need 6-8 sessions for body areas such as underarms and legs. Facial hair usually requires 8-12 sessions because the hair is finer and more influenced by hormones. The exact number of treatments depends on hair color, skin type, hormonal factors, and the specific area treated.
Darker, coarser hair often responds more quickly than fine or light-colored hair. Sessions are typically spaced 6-8 weeks apart so the laser can target hair during the active growth phase.
Best Laser Type for Dark Skin in St. Petersburg
Nd:YAG lasers at a 1064 nm wavelength are widely considered the gold standard for darker skin types IV through VI. These lasers penetrate deeper into the skin while largely bypassing surface melanin, which lowers the risk of burns and pigment changes.
Modern diode lasers with multiple wavelengths, especially those that include a 1064 nm option, also provide strong safety profiles for darker skin. The most important factor is working with an experienced provider who understands how to adjust settings for your exact skin tone and hair type.

Medications to Review Before Laser Hair Removal
Photosensitizing medications can increase the risk of burns and other complications. Common examples include doxycycline and other tetracycline antibiotics, which usually need to be stopped about 2 weeks before treatment with medical approval. Retinoids such as Accutane may require a waiting period of several months after completion.
Certain acne medications, blood thinners, and drugs that affect wound healing also deserve careful review. Always share a complete list of prescriptions, supplements, and over-the-counter products with your provider during consultation so you receive personalized guidance.
How Long Laser Hair Removal Results Last in St. Pete
Well-performed laser hair removal often achieves 80-90% permanent hair reduction in treated areas. Any remaining hair usually grows in finer and lighter than before treatment. Many clients enjoy long-lasting smoothness with only occasional maintenance sessions every 1-2 years.
Results are considered permanent because treated follicles typically cannot regenerate. New follicles can still appear over time due to hormonal changes, which explains why some people choose periodic touch-up sessions.
